War crimes trial of general begins

Former Croatian Gen. Ante Gotovina went on trial at the war crimes tribunal for the former Yugoslavia, charged with driving as many as 200,000 Serbs from a rebel enclave in a military offensive that made him a hero in his homeland.
Gotovina and fellow Gens. Ivan Cermak and Mladen Markac are accused at The Hague tribunal of orchestrating the killing of hundreds of people and the shelling and burning of towns and villages as Croatian forces retook the Serb-controlled Krajina region in 1995.
